Javivi was born on June 20, 1961 in Hervás, Cáceres, Extremadura (Spain) as Javier Gil Valle. He is an actor, known for Lalola (2008), Washington Wolves (1999), Ana y los 7 (2002), Growing Up (2018) and Gàbia (2019). Suffers from a stutter. His screen name "Javivi" is a consequence of that, coming from how he pronounced his first name Javier.
